 #6: Holiday Canapés & La Marca Prosecco
Every good drinks party needs some finger food to serve alongside the fizz. A canape is a small, one-or-two bite hors d'oeuvre, usually consisting of a piece of bread or cracker topped with, well, anything.

 #1: Beef Wellington Bites & 2017 Wade Cellars Cabernet Sauvignon Oakville
The classic dish of beef Wellington bites is perfect for before-dinner bites. Packaged puff pastry makes easy work of the pastry wrapping, while onions and mushrooms round out the beef.
